WebMar 16, 2024 · Guardianship is the form of grandparent custody that gives grandparents the most rights without the actual adoption of the grandchildren. 3. Guardianship may have slightly different meanings according to your state of residence, so be sure to double check all information with local laws. WebNov 11, 2024 · Guidance should absolutely be sought from the ICPC Articles (primarily article VIII) and Regulations (primarily regulations 2, 9, and 12). Generally speaking if a state agency, charitable organization, or private adoption agency is seeking to send a child to another state for the purpose of fostering or adoption, the compact will apply.
